The video tutorial covers polite phrases for ordering or asking for something, focusing on pronunciation and usage. It explains how to use 'I'd like', 'I'll have', 'Could I', 'May I', and 'Can I' in different contexts, emphasizing the importance of politeness and correct pronunciation. The tutorial also provides detailed phonetic breakdowns of each phrase, helping learners understand the nuances of English pronunciation.
